To be honest, now that I’m tearing down my berry orchard, this is the first time I’ve been mad at the game mechanics. This player has never been seen in town. They came and plotted something that was abandoned 4 weeks after the game launched and I’ve never seen them since. I plotted this land soon after the farming update and it’s a little ridiculous that it’s suddenly a forbidden zone that won’t be touched for years just because this player hasn’t turned off beacon reservations.

Something needs to be done about this sort of thing.

Right after they added the new system, there were shops that couldn’t be transferred due to the reservation system being on by default. When a couple of shops removed their beacon so they could trade them to another player, they “lost” plots bc some shops were older and we needed help with that.

And I needed help when a shop beacon (that was given to me) took out the whole mall’s walkway, when I deleted that beacon (was not the master beacon). Strange occurrence.
